Concrete Lifting Sobieski
Concrete lifting, also called slabjacking, foamjacking or mudjacking is the act of boring holes right into concrete and injecting material below the slab in order to elevate it to quality. TCS only uses high-density polyurethane foam for lasting fixings.

Deep Foam Injection
Deep foam injection includes driving long rods right into ground to infuse high density polyurethane foam in dirts. This can be used to stabilize or lift dirts and structures, as well as displace water.Residential Concrete Lifting Contractor

Spray Foam Insulation Sobieski
Spray polyurethane foam insulation can be used in both household and industrial building and constructions. Spray polyurethane foam can be bought in shut or open cell forms. Because it acts as an insulation, air seal and vapor barrier, shut cell foam is terrific for cooler environment areas. This product is really a three-in-one and considerably boosts the structure’s toughness. Spray foam is costly upfront, however it can save you as much as 50% on your cooling and home heating expenses. This will certainly result in a quick return on investment.
Blown In Insulation Sobieski
Blown-in fiberglass and cellulose are generally used in attic rooms in a loose fill method. Blown-in insulation can also be used in wall surface systems with the BIBS (blown in blanket system) or dense pack. TCS gives both solutions to clients based on our clients needs and budget.
